Stylish café, Bar & Grill is looking to recruit a chef to join their small team.
Chef required to join the team.
- £15.00 per hour DOE
- 40-45 hours a week
The candidate must have a solid fresh food background, ideally with some wood-fired pizza oven experience, but this is not essential.
This chef position will suit an experienced Chef de Partie or Sous chef.
